Pablo Ezequiel Calderón (born 13 May 1998) is an Argentine professional footballer who plays as a centre-back for Chilean club Ñublense.[1]
Career
Calderón, alongside his brother, joined the youth system of Unión Santa Fe from Cooperativista in 2015 following a successful trial.[2][3] They had previously played in the ranks of Charata Juniors.[3][4] Four years later, in 2019, he was released by the club.[2] Calderón subsequently headed to Costa Rican football with Liga FPD side Jicaral.[5] He made his senior and professional debut on 19 September 2019 in an away win against Cartaginés.[1][6] Fifteen further appearances followed across 2019–20.[1] In August 2020, after leaving Jicaral, Calderón rejoined Argentine Primera División outfit Unión Santa Fe; penning a two-year contract.[2][7][8]
For the 2024 season, Calderón signed with Deportivo Madryn.[9]
In 2025, Calderón moved to Chile and signed with Ñublense.[10]
Personal life
Calderón is the twin brother of fellow professional footballer Franco Calderón.[2][7]
